package mil.tatrc.physiology.utilities.testing.validation;

import java.io.*;
import java.util.*;

import mil.tatrc.physiology.utilities.Log;

import org.apache.poi.xssf.usermodel.XSSFCell;
import org.apache.poi.xssf.usermodel.XSSFColor;
import org.apache.poi.xssf.usermodel.XSSFRow;
import org.apache.poi.xssf.usermodel.XSSFSheet;
import org.apache.poi.xssf.usermodel.XSSFWorkbook;

public class ValidationMatrix {
    protected static final String success = "<span class=\"success\">";
    protected static final String warning = "<span class=\"warning\">";
    protected static final String danger = "<span class=\"danger\">";
    protected static final String endSpan = "</span>";

    public static void main(String[] args) throws Exception {
        String from = "../docs/Validation/Scenarios/";
        String to = "./validation/";

        if (args.length == 2) {
            from = args[0];
            to = args[1];
        }

        File dir = new File(from);
        if (!dir.exists() || !dir.isDirectory()) {
            Log.error("Source directory does not exists or is not a directory");
            return;
        }

        for (File f : dir.listFiles())
            ValidationMatrix.convert(f.getAbsolutePath(), to);
    }

    enum Agreement {
        NA, Good, Ok, Bad
    };

    public static class SheetSummary {
        public String name;
        public String description;
        public String validationType;
        public short goodAgreement = 0;
        public short okAgreement = 0;
        public short badAgreement = 0;
    }

    public static class Sheet {
        public SheetSummary summary;
        public List<List<Cell>> table = new ArrayList<List<Cell>>();
    }

    public static class Cell {
        public Cell(String text, Agreement agreement, Map<String, String> refs) {
            this.agreement = agreement;
            this.text = text;
            if (this.text == null || this.text.isEmpty())
                return;
            this.text = this.text.replaceAll("\n", " ");
            // <br> in tables don't do anything
            //this.text = this.text.replaceAll(";", "<br>");
            //this.text = this.text.replaceAll(".", "<br>");
            switch (this.agreement) {
            case Good:
                this.text = success + this.text + endSpan;
                break;
            case Ok:
                this.text = warning + this.text + endSpan;
                break;
            case Bad:
                this.text = danger + this.text + endSpan;
                break;
            }
            int i = 0;
            for (String key : refs.keySet())
                this.text = this.text.replaceAll(key, refs.get(key));
        }

        public String text;
        public Agreement agreement;
    }

    public static void convert(String from, String to) throws IOException {
        FileInputStream xlFile = new FileInputStream(new File(from));
        // Read workbook into HSSFWorkbook
        XSSFWorkbook xlWBook = new XSSFWorkbook(xlFile);
        List<SheetSummary> sheetSummaries = new ArrayList<SheetSummary>();// has to be an ordered list as sheet names can only be so long
        Map<String, String> refs = new HashMap<String, String>();

        List<Sheet> Sheets = new ArrayList<Sheet>();

        for (int s = 0; s < xlWBook.getNumberOfSheets(); s++) {
            XSSFSheet xlSheet = xlWBook.getSheetAt(s);
            Log.info("Processing Sheet : " + xlSheet.getSheetName());
            if (xlSheet.getSheetName().equals("Summary")) {
                int rows = xlSheet.getPhysicalNumberOfRows();
                for (int r = 1; r < rows; r++) {
                    XSSFRow row = xlSheet.getRow(r);
                    if (row == null)
                        continue;
                    SheetSummary ss = new SheetSummary();
                    sheetSummaries.add(ss);
                    ss.name = row.getCell(0).getStringCellValue();
                    ss.description = row.getCell(1).getStringCellValue();
                    ss.validationType = row.getCell(2).getStringCellValue();
                }
            } else if (xlSheet.getSheetName().equals("References")) {
                int rows = xlSheet.getPhysicalNumberOfRows();
                for (int r = 1; r < rows; r++) {
                    XSSFRow row = xlSheet.getRow(r);
                    if (row == null)
                        continue;
                    refs.put("\\[" + r + "\\]", "@cite " + row.getCell(1).getStringCellValue());
                }
            } else {
                int rows = xlSheet.getPhysicalNumberOfRows();
                Sheet sheet = new Sheet();
                sheet.summary = sheetSummaries.get(s - 2);
                Sheets.add(sheet);

                int cells = xlSheet.getRow(0).getPhysicalNumberOfCells();

                for (int r = 0; r < rows; r++) {
                    XSSFRow row = xlSheet.getRow(r);
                    if (row == null)
                        continue;

                    String cellValue = null;

                    for (int c = 0; c < cells; c++) {
                        List<Cell> column;
                        if (r == 0) {
                            column = new ArrayList<Cell>();
                            sheet.table.add(column);
                        } else {
                            column = sheet.table.get(c);
                        }

                        XSSFCell cell = row.getCell(c);
                        if (cell == null) {
                            column.add(new Cell("", Agreement.NA, refs));
                            continue;
                        }
                        cellValue = null;
                        switch (cell.getCellType()) {
                        case XSSFCell.CELL_TYPE_NUMERIC:
                            cellValue = Double.toString(cell.getNumericCellValue());
                            break;
                        case XSSFCell.CELL_TYPE_STRING:
                            cellValue = cell.getStringCellValue();
                            break;
                        }
                        if (cellValue == null || cellValue.isEmpty())
                            column.add(new Cell("", Agreement.NA, refs));
                        else {
                            Agreement a = Agreement.NA;
                            XSSFColor color = cell.getCellStyle().getFillForegroundColorColor();
                            if (color != null) {
                                byte[] rgb = color.getRGB();
                                if (rgb[0] < -25 && rgb[1] > -25 && rgb[2] < -25) {
                                    a = Agreement.Good;
                                    sheet.summary.goodAgreement++;
                                } else if (rgb[0] > -25 && rgb[1] > -25 && rgb[2] < -25) {
                                    a = Agreement.Ok;
                                    sheet.summary.okAgreement++;
                                } else if (rgb[0] > -25 && rgb[1] < -25 && rgb[2] < -25) {
                                    a = Agreement.Bad;
                                    sheet.summary.badAgreement++;
                                }
                            }
                            column.add(new Cell(cellValue, a, refs));
                        }
                    }
                }
            }
        }
        xlWBook.close();
        xlFile.close(); //close xls

        // Generate our Tables for each Sheet
        PrintWriter writer = null;
        try {
            String name = from.substring(from.lastIndexOf('/') + 1, from.lastIndexOf('.')) + "Scenarios";

            writer = new PrintWriter(to + name + "Summary.md", "UTF-8");
            writer.println(
                    "|Scenario|Description|Validation Type|Good agreement|General agreement with deviations|Some major disagreements|");
            writer.println("|--- |--- |:---: |:---: |:---: |:---: |");
            for (Sheet sheet : Sheets) {
                writer.println("|" + sheet.summary.name + "|" + sheet.summary.description + "|"
                        + sheet.summary.validationType + "|" + success + sheet.summary.goodAgreement + endSpan + "|"
                        + warning + sheet.summary.okAgreement + endSpan + "|" + danger + sheet.summary.badAgreement
                        + endSpan + "|");
            }
            writer.close();

            // Create file and start the table
            writer = new PrintWriter(to + name + ".md", "UTF-8");
            writer.println(name + " {#" + name + "}");
            writer.println("=======");
            writer.println();

            writer.println();

            for (Sheet sheet : Sheets) {
                Log.info("Writing table : " + sheet.summary.name);
                writer.println("## " + sheet.summary.name);

                writer.println(sheet.summary.description);
                writer.println("We used a " + sheet.summary.validationType + " validation method(s).");
                writer.println("");

                for (int row = 0; row < sheet.table.get(0).size(); row++) {
                    for (int col = 0; col < sheet.table.size(); col++) {
                        writer.print("|" + sheet.table.get(col).get(row).text);
                    }
                    writer.println("|");
                    if (row == 0) {
                        for (int col = 0; col < sheet.table.size(); col++) {
                            writer.print("|---   ");
                        }
                        writer.println("|");
                    }
                }
                writer.println();
                writer.println();
            }
            writer.close();
        } catch (Exception ex) {
            Log.error("Error writing tables for " + from, ex);
            writer.close();
        }
    }

    protected static String pad(String s, int max) {
        if (s == null)
            return new String(new char[(max + 5)]).replace('\0', ' ');
        // Using a pad of 5 between columns
        try {
            String ret = s + new String(new char[(max - s.length()) + 5]).replace('\0', ' ');
            return ret;
        } catch (Exception ex) {
            Log.error("Could not pad " + s + " with a max of " + max, ex);
            return "";
        }
    }

}
